How do schools accessible from Palm Jumeirah handle complaints about transport quality

Schools accessible from Palm Jumeirah, such as those in Dubai Marina or Jumeirah, follow structured complaint procedures for transport quality. Parents typically contact the school's transport coordinator or administration first. Most institutions adhere to Dubai's Knowledge and Human Development Authority (KHDA) guidelines, ensuring safe and reliable student transport. Complaints are logged, investigated, and resolved through formal channels, often involving contracted bus services to address punctuality, vehicle condition, or driver behavior. For Palm Jumeirah residents, start by documenting specific transport issues with times, dates, and details. Contact the school's transport office or bus supervisor directly. Escalate to the principal if unresolved, and use online portals or dedicated complaint emails common in Dubai schools. Keep records of all communications. Involving the Parent-Teacher Association can help. Reference KHDA standards for leverage. Persistent problems may require route changes or provider switches. Always submit concerns in writing for accountability and follow-up within the UAE's regulatory framework.

when are nebraska property taxes due

In Nebraska, property taxes for a given year are officially due on December 31st. In practice, most homeowners pay in two installments the following year, with each half required before becoming delinquent. Exact payment schedules and deadlines can vary slightly depending on the county, so it’s important to check with your local tax office.

does new york state charge interest on back property taxes

In New York State, delinquent property taxes are subject to interest and penalties. While the state’s Real Property Tax Law mandates that these charges apply, the exact rates and collection schedules are set by local governments, such as counties, towns, or cities, ensuring that late payments incur additional costs.

how to lower property taxes in ny

In New York, you can lower your property taxes by applying for available exemptions, including those for seniors, veterans, or through the STAR program. If you believe your property’s assessed value is too high, you can also file a formal challenge or appeal with local assessor’s office, providing evidence like comparable sales or property condition details, to potentially reduce your tax.

how much are property taxes in north carolina

In North Carolina, property taxes are assessed and collected at the local level, with an average effective rate ranging from about 0.62% to 0.70% of a home's assessed value, which is below the national average. The actual tax you pay depends on the specific county and municipality, as each local government sets its own rates and may levy additional special assessments or fees.
